f:614 -    Addressing the Holy Prophet (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am) as father

Question:     A certain speaker addressed the Holy Prophet (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am) as "My father" in his speech, although he is not a Syed.  Is it correct to use such words for the Holy Prophet (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am)?

Answer:     Allah (Subhanahu Wa Ta'ala) made the Holy Prophet (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am) the leader of all Prophets and made Him the Seal of all Prophets (Khatim Un Nabiyyeen) and Allah (Subhanahu Wa Ta'ala) forbade addressing the Holy Prophet (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am) as father.  As given in Surah Ahzaab.

Hadhrat Muhammad (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am) is not the father of any of your men, but (he is) the Messenger of Allah, and the Seal of the Prophets: and Allah has full knowledge of all things. Surah Ahzaab (33:40)

A Muslim loves the Holy Prophet (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am) much more than son loves his father; however, addressing the Holy Prophet (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am) as father is against the Holy Quran (Nas Qata'i)

Yes, the Holy Prophet (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am) is as affectionate as a father and brought up the Ummah the way father raises his children.  He (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am) did not leave any aspect of life ungoverned or unguided.  The Holy Prophet (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am) said about this:

Translation of Hadith:  It has been narrated on the authority of Hadhrat Abu Hurairah (May Allah be well pleased with him) that the Holy Prophet (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am): Verily! I am like a father for his children.  (Sunan Abu Dawood, Vol. 1, Pg No. 3)

In the explanation of this Hadith, Hadhrat Mulla Ali Qari (May Allah shower His Mercy on him) writes in Mirqatul Mafateeh, Sharh Mishkatul Masabeeh, Vol. 1, Pg No. 289:

Translation: I am like a father to you in affection and benevolence.  I teach you the affairs of your Deen.  Allama Khitabi (May Allah shower His Mercy on him) writes: In this Hadith, for the addressee, there is a clarification and an expression of love, so that the person is not awed and does not feel shy about asking those things about the Deen, which are needed; the way a child is with a father.

It is not at all allowed for anybody in the Ummah to address the Holy Prophet (Sallallahu alaihi wa sallam) as "Father."  The person who said these words should perform Tauba, as what he said is against the stated verse of the Holy Quran.
